Conception of inerrancy that holds that the bible is fully true in all matters of science, history, and theology.

Absolute inerrancy that holds that the bible is fully true in all matters of science, history, and theology.

I believe the answer is: absolute inerrancy

absolute inerrancy is the justification that Christian often use to state that all events in bible is accurate no matter what findings might be found that could disprove it. 3 examples of a primary social group​
OLga [1]

Answer:

A primary group is a group in which one exchanges implicit items, such as love, caring, concern, support, etc. Examples of these would be family groups, love relationships, crisis support groups, and church groups. Relationships formed in primary groups are often long lasting and goals in themselves.
